The Summer EBT program provides grocery benefits to families with school-aged children in our community. Last year, Summer EBT helped over 395,000 kids in Kentucky get the healthy food that they usually enjoy while they’re in school!
· Summer EBT is for school-aged children in households that are at or under 185% of federal poverty guidelines.
· Families receive $120 per eligible school-aged child for groceries (on an existing EBT card or new Summer EBT card)
· Most eligible families will be automatically enrolled, but some will need to apply.
· In CEP school(s), families who aren’t receiving SNAP, KTAP, income-based Medicaid or Kinship Care may need to apply. (This is new, not all CEP students will receive a card- the ones who are not directly certified from the above programs, will have to complete a S-EBT application with DCBS)
· Families can check here if they need to apply, or if they should receive Summer EBT automatically: feedingky.org/sebteligibility
Families can learn more about Summer EBT in Kentucky at bit.ly/KY-SummerEBT "
*Non-CEP schools, if your student qualified directly (through the above DC programs), they would receive benefits automatically. If your household completed a Free/Reduced application for meal assistance, DCBS has requested that data from districts, so you should not need to complete the S-EBT application.
If you have any questions contact DCBS (S-EBT program distributers) at: (855)509-8959.
Beneficios de P-EBT del Verano
$120 de beneficio para cada estudiante
Las familias con niños que asisten escuela con ingresos de 185% o menos del nivel de pobreza o que asisten una escuela de CEP pueden calificar
Aplica en línea hoy
bit.ly/KY-SummerEBT
Los niños de 6-18 años antes de la fecha 1 de agoto, 2024 que reciben beneficios de SNAP, KTAP, o "Kinship Care" durante el año escolar 2024-2025 estarán inscritos automaticamente en el programa y no necesitan que aplicar.
